This role will begin in October 2026 and conclude in December 2026. The internship is located in the Orange County and South Los Angeles region including Fullerton, Irvine, Costa Mesa, Long Beach and Torrance territories. This role is for students in enrolled their final semester at a college/university obtaining a bachelor's degree and graduating by December 2026. This position is part time and we offer $21.28 per hour.
